I agree with you that a lot of the questions didn't have answers that fit me. But that's always the way with multiple choice questions.

Speaking of which, when I was teaching math my students kept bugging me foi multiple choice questions, since they thought they would be easier. So finally I said, okay.

I gave them a multiple choice test. But every set of answers had a "none of the above" option. So they still had to do the question precisely, because 1/5th of the questions didn't have the right answer, and if they only guessed at the closest answer then risked getting it wrong anyhow. They were annoyed. I told them, be careful what you wish for, your wish may come true. Didn't seem to make than any happier. LOL!
